In a dramatic turn of events, Siren, a decentralized finance (DeFi) protocol, has experienced a catastrophic decline in its token value, plummeting by a staggering 75%. This sharp drop in price follows a major sell-off by a prominent whale, who offloaded 17 million Siren tokens, significantly influencing market sentiment and stability.
The incident, which unfolded on June 13, 2026, has sent shockwaves through the crypto community, raising eyebrows about the volatility and risks associated with digital assets. The whale’s actions not only impacted Siren’s price but also triggered a cascade of selling among smaller investors, further exacerbating the situation.
At the peak of its value, Siren had been a rising star in the DeFi space, boasting innovative features aimed at enhancing liquidity and trading efficiency. However, the recent sell-off has cast a pall over its prospects, leading to concerns about the overall health of the project and its long-term viability.
Market analysts have noted that the sudden influx of tokens into the market created an imbalance between supply and demand, which is often a precursor to significant price drops. As panic set in, many investors rushed to liquidate their holdings, contributing to the rapid decline.
